Nearly $6,000 seized in gambling arrest
GAINESVILLE Agents with the Multi Agency Narcotics Squad seized over $5,800 in an undercover gambling investigation. Friday, agents arrested one man after executing a search warrant at a Gainesville business known as Tres Amigo Lavaderia, located at 224 Atlanta Highway.
